Skip to content

Commit f150eb0

Browse files
committed
use correct base of zero for constant interval
1 parent 2eff890 commit f150eb0

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

openai-client/src/main/scala/io/cequence/openaiscala/RetryHelpers.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@ object RetryHelpers {
1616
delayBase: Double = 2
1717
) {
1818
def constantInterval(interval: FiniteDuration): RetrySettings =
19-
copy(delayBase = 1).copy(delayOffset = interval)
19+
copy(delayBase = 0).copy(delayOffset = interval)
2020
}
2121
object RetrySettings {
2222
def apply(interval: FiniteDuration): RetrySettings =

openai-client/src/test/scala/io/cequence/openaiscala/RetryHelpersSpec.scala

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@ class RetryHelpersSpec
3434
"allow easy configuration of a constant interval" in {
3535
val interval = 10.seconds
3636
val result = RetrySettings(interval)
37-
result.delayBase shouldBe 1
37+
result.delayBase shouldBe 0
3838
result.delayOffset shouldBe interval
3939
}
4040
}

0 commit comments

Comments
 (0)